War in Ukraine today: latest news, September 03, 2023 (photo)

It has been the 557 th day of the Ukrainian resistance to the russian military aggression. 

What happened in Ukraine today:

Here is operational information of the General Staff as of 6 pm:   

The enemy launched 1 missile and 39 air strikes, 24 MLRS attacks at the positions of Ukrainian troops and various settlements. The russian terrorist attacks have killed and wounded civilians. Residential buildings and other civilian infrastructure were damaged.

Ukraine is still under the threat of missile and air strikes.

There were 25 combat engagements.

Towards Volyn and Polissia, there were no significant changes. 

Towards Siversk and Sloboda, the enemy  launched an airstrike in the vicinity of Strilecha, Kharkiv oblast. The invaders fired from mortar and artillery at more than 10 settlements, including Vorozhba, Mezenivka, Kindrativka, Ulanove, Sumy oblast, Vovchansk, Hatyshche, Budarky, Neskuchne, Kharkiv oblast.

Towards Kupiansk, the settlements of Topoli, Dvorichanske, Kolodiazne, Kyslivka, Kharkiv oblast came under enemy artillery fire.

Towards Lyman, the enemy conducted unsuccessful offensives in the vicinity of Novoiehorivka, Luhansk oblast. The invaders launched airstrikes in the vicinities of Cherneshchyna, Kharkiv oblast, Bilohorivka, Luhansk oblast, and Spirne, Donetsk oblast. The enemy fired artillery at more than 10 settlements, including Nevske, Bilohorivka, Luhansk oblast,  Verkhniokamyanske, Spirne, Rozdolivka, Donetsk oblast.

Towards Bakhmut, the enemy launched air strikes in the vicinity of Bohdanivka, Klishchiyivka, Kurdiumivka, Pivnichne, Donetsk oblast. Over 10 settlements, including Bohdanivka, Chasiv Yar, Ivanivske, Pivnichne, Donetsk oblast, suffered from artillery shelling. 

Towards Avdiivka, the enemy conducted unsuccessful offensives in the vicinity of Avdiivka, Donetsk oblast. They continue to fire from artillery and mortar at various settlements, including Nevelske, Karlivka, Avdiyivka, Sieverne, Novokalynove, Donetsk oblast.

Towards Mariinka, the Ukrainian Defense Forces continue to hold back the russian offensive in the vicinity of Mariinka, Donetsk oblast. The invaders fired from artillery at the settlements of Krasnohorivka, Mariinka, Heorhiyivka, Pobieda, Novomykhailivka, Donetsk oblast. 

Towards Shakhtarsk, the invaders fired from artillery at more than 10 settlements, including Vuhledar, Vodyane, Prechystivka, Urozhaine, Donetsk oblast.

Towards Zaporizhzhia, the invaders conducted unsuccessful offensives in the vicinity of Pryiutne, Zaporizhzhia oblast. The adversary launched air strikes in the vicinity of Mala Tokmachka, Novodanylivka and Robotyne, Zaporizhzhia oblast.The enemy fired from artillery at more than 15 settlements, including Levadne, Malynivka, Chervone, Huliaipilske, Orikhiv, Kamyanske, Zaporizhzhia oblast.

Towards Kherson, the enemy launched air strikes in the vicinity of Antonivka, Mykolaivka and Olhivka, Kherson oblast. The settlement of Mykolaivka, Kherson oblast, and the city of Kherson suffered from enemy artillery and mortar shelling.

At the same time, the Ukrainian Defense Forces continue to conduct the offensive operation towards Melitopol, consolidating their positions and conducting counter-battery fire.

The Ukrainian Air Force launched 9 air strikes on the buildup of manpower, weapon, and military equipment, as well as 5 airstrikes on the anti-aircraft missile systems.

The Ukrainian rocket and artillery troops hit 10 artillery systems at their firing positions and 1 anti-aircraft missile system of the enemy.

According to the commander of the “Tavria” group Oleksandr Tarnavskyi, the Armed Forces of Ukraine broke through russia’s first line of defense in the south. Currently, Ukrainian troops are expanding the front of the breakthrough in both directions.

During August 2023, russia launched 231 kamikaze drones and 167 missiles on the territory of Ukraine. This was reported by the monitoring group. Ukrainian air defense managed to destroy 152 UAVs and 92 missiles.

Recent war events in the east of Ukraine

Kharkiv oblast

Oleh Syniehubov, Head of Kharkiv Regional Military Administration, reported that yesterday settlements of Kharkiv, Chuhuiv, Kupiansk and Izium regions wrre under russian attacks.

Specifically, the enemy shelled Kozacha Lopan, Ohirtseve, Vovchanski Khytory, Varvarivka, Kamianka and other settlements with artillery, mortars and aviation.

The enemy attacked Cherneshchyna and Shyikivka villages, Izium region, with guided bombs. In Cherneshchyna, the bomb hit near the local school. In Shyikivka, private residential building and outbuildings were damaged. There were no casualties.

Destructions. Photo: telegram channel of Oleh Syniehubov/Kharkiv Regional Military Administration

Mine clearance is ongoing. Pyrotechnics of the State Emergency Service examined more than 4.5 hectares of the territory and defused 55 explosive ordnance.

Donetsk oblast

According to Donetsk Regional Military Administration, yesterday evening, russians shelled Kramatorsk with Smerch MRLs, damaging 4 buildings and moren than 20 graves in the local cemetery. 

Towards Volnovakha, 2 people were killed and 2 more injured, a building was partially destroyed in Vuhledar. A cultural establishment was damaged in Novoukrainka.

Towards Donetsk, russians attacked the outskirts of Kurakhove in the morning. There were isolated attacks in Avdiivka.

Towards Horlivka, a residential building and transmission lines were damaged in Toretsk. Rozdolivka and Vasiukivka of Soledar community were targeted.

Towards Lysychansk, 1 building in Zvanivka and 1 in Vasiukivka were destroyed. Lyman was shelled 20 times.

Destructions. Photo: Donetsk Regional Military Administration

Luhansk oblast

According to Luhansk Regional Military Administration, after a short pause, the invaders became active again near Novoiehorivka. It took them some time to recover from significant losses in personnel and equipment. Specifically, several enemy tanks were burned over the past week. However, yesterday’s offensive also failed to bring results for the enemy. Also russians conducted air strikes near Bilohorivka and Miasozharivka. Makiivka, Nevske and Bilohorivka were hit with enemy artillery.

In the villages around Svatove, russians also failed the passportisation in time for their September elections. In order to increase the turnout, they continue to issue russian documents on election days. Older people are threatened by being deprived of social benefits, being unable to use administrative services and being denied in medical assistance.

Since last year, Lysychansk utility workers have not been paid their salaries, this includes representatives of the local water utility. Recently, water supply has stopped in those houses where it was restored earlier. The population is forced to use technical water which they also need to wait for at the points of delivery.

A stocking factory in occupied Rubizhne was almost destroyed by enemy shells and looted by russians. This is a production facility, which operates more than 27 years, has not been stopped by the war. Despite the fact that all the facilities, material and technical base and newly purchased equipment remained in the temporarily occupied territories but the production was restored in the Lviv oblast.

Latest news from the front of the southern regions of Ukraine

Zaporizhzhia oblast

Ukrainian forces have broken through the first line of defense held by russian forces near Zaporizhzhia after weeks of careful demining. They are now anticipating faster progress as Ukrainian forces advance towards the weaker second line of defense of the russian army. Brigadier General Oleksandr Tarnavskyi, the commander of the operational-strategic group of troops “Tavria,” revealed this in an exclusive interview with The Observer.

Yesterday, the enemy conducted 120 shelling attacks on 25 populated areas in the Vasylivka and Polohy regionss. russian forces carried out 91 artillery shelling attacks on the territory of Huliaipole, Orikhiv, Novodarivka, Levadne, Mala Tokmachka, Shcherbakivka, Mayinivka, Kamianei, Stepove, and other villages along the front line. Fourteen aerial strikes targeted Orikhiv and Robotyne, while 11 shelling attacks with multiple rocket launchers hit Orikhiv, Huliaipole, Chervone, Novodarivka, Novodanylivka, Levadne, and Lukianivske. Moreover, Novodarivka, Levadne, Novoivanivka, and Plavni were attacked by drones. Damage or destruction of 21 civilian infrastructure objects was recorded.

On September 2, six fires broke out in the front-line city of Orikhiv as a result of massive russian shelling. Firefighters extinguished the fires, and there were no casualties or injuries.

Emergency services’ sappers confiscated 3 rounds from a handheld anti-tank grenade launcher and 1 mortar mine in a populated area in Zaporizhzhia oblast. The explosive items were safely disposed of in accordance with safety procedures.

Mykolaiv oblast

Yesterday, russian forces conducted four strikes on the waters of Ochakiv community in Mykolaiv oblast. There were no reported casualties. This information was provided by the head of Mykolaiv RMA, Vitalii Kim.

36-year-old local resident blew up on a mine in Chornomorka, Mykolaiv oblast. This was reported by Serhii Bratchuk, the head of the Public Council at Odesa RMA, citing information from the “South” Operational Command. The man ignored warning signs indicating the presence of mines and went swimming, resulting in a fatal explosion.

DTEK Renewebles company has received an award from the American magazine POWER for the courage and resilience of the company’s energy workers who constructed the first phase of the Tylihulska Wind Power Plant with a capacity of 114 MW, despite being located just 100 kilometers from the front line.

Three thousand residents of Mykolaiv oblast have  joined the “Restoration Army.” This program provides an opportunity for people who have not found permanent employment to receive a salary and extends the period of their financing by the employment center. This information was shared by the director of  Mykolaiv Regional Employment Center, Dmytro Oboronko.

Odesa oblast

According to the “South” Operational Command, russian army attacked the port infrastructure on Danube River in Odesa oblast using iranian combat drones of the “Shakhed” type. The occupiers carried out several waves of attacks using UAVs “Shakhed-136/131” from the south and southeast directions (Cape Chauda, Crimea, and Primorsko-Ohtarsk, russia). In total, 25 “Shakhed-136/131” combat drones launches were detected, with 22 of them being destroyed. As a result of the attacks, the port infrastructure was damaged, and a fire broke out, which was promptly extinguished by the State Emergency Service (DSNS). Two civilian port workers were injured and hospitalized. All relevant services are working at the scene. Law enforcement agencies are documenting the consequences of russia’s war crimes.

On September 2, a drone of the russian army was shot down in the Odesa blast. It was a reconnaissance-strike UAV Mohajer-6, a rare drone of iranian origin. This information was reported by the “South” Operational Command.

The russian army deployed a small missile ship of the “Buyan-M” project, equipped with eight “Kalibr” missiles, to the Black Sea for combat duty. As of the morning, the russian naval group consisted of 12 units, with ten ships in the Black Sea and two in the Sea of Azov. This information was provided by the “South” Operational Command.

Illegally placed advertising billboards on the M-05 Kyiv-Odesa highway were dismantled. All dismantled metal structures are planned to be transferred to military units. This was reported by the Service for the Restoration and Development of Infrastructure in Odesa oblast.

Kherson oblast

On the night of September 3, the russian army shelled Kherson, injuring two people. This was reported by the press office of Kherson RMA. The shelling of the city occurred at around 01:00. Additionally, yesterday at around 22:00, russians shelled Bilozirka, where an elderly man sustained leg injuries.

Yesterday, the enemy carried out 79 shelling attacks, firing 510 rounds from mortars, artillery, tanks, “Grad” MLRS, drones, aircraft, and ZU-23 anti-aircraft guns. The enemy fired 14 shells at the city of Kherson. russian forces targeted residential areas of populated settlements in the region, as well as a religious structure in the city of Kherson. The occupiers shelled a kindergarten in Bilozirka with rocket artillery, damaging the roof and shattering several windows. Due to russian aggression, one person was killed, and six others have been injured.

On September 2, the Defense Forces destroyed 95 russian military personnel, five armored vehicles, and three boats used for maneuvering in Kherson oblast. This information was provided by the head of the Unified Coordination Press Center of the Defense and Security of the South, Natalia Humeniuk.

As part of the “Shoulder to Shoulder” initiative, 15 regions of Ukraine have already constructed 360 houses in 26 villages and towns in Kherson oblast. This was reported by Kherson RMA. Inspections of objects are ongoing in the populated areas included in the second phase of the program before the start of repair work.

International support of Ukraine in the russian-Ukrainian war (russia’s invasion of Ukraine)

Oleksii Reznikov, Minister of Defense of Ukraine, announced that since the war began, Western partners have continued to provide assistance to Ukraine in the form of weapons, equipment, and ammunition in the amount of about $100 billion.

Ukraine is negotiating with the EU countries on the return of top fugitive corrupt officials. “Conditionally, this will not happen on a huge scale tomorrow… Those who stole the most will go first. We will try to get them first. And the middle fish and other characters will go later,” said Denys Malyuska, Minister of Justice of Ukraine.

Germany will protect the airspace of Slovakia, which gave Ukraine air defense equipment and MiG aircraft. 2 Eurofighter combat aircraft of the 74th Squadron of the Tactical Air Force, stationed in Upper Bavaria, will be constantly ready to intercept unidentified or hostile objects in the airspace of Slovakia in the event of an emergency.

In Germany, a russian woman was not allowed on the plane because of her citizenship. She wanted to fly on the Bremen-Frankfurt-Tallinn route to get from Estonia to russia. However, the German airline Lufthansa  refused her because of her russian citizenship. As the carrier explained, Estonia has banned all citizens of the aggressor country from passing through its territory.
